Summary:
The Brentwood School District in New Hampshire is home to one exceptional elementary school, Swasey Central School, which serves 295 students from pre-kindergarten through 4th grade. This standout institution has consistently demonstrated academic excellence, earning a 5-star rating from SchoolDigger and ranking 15th out of 224 elementary schools in the state for the 2024-2025 school year.
Swasey Central School's performance on state assessments is truly remarkable, with 74% of students proficient or better in both Math and Reading, far surpassing the state averages of 42% and 55%, respectively. The school's 3rd and 4th grade Math proficiency rates are particularly impressive, at 82% and 84%, compared to the state averages of 53% and 52%. Additionally, the school's 5th grade Science proficiency rate of 63% is well above the state average of 38%. These exceptional results suggest a strong focus on STEM education and effective teaching strategies in these subject areas.
The Brentwood School District as a whole is also highly regarded, ranking 10th out of 158 districts in New Hampshire and earning a 5-star rating from SchoolDigger. This indicates that the success of Swasey Central School is part of a broader trend of excellence within the district, providing a high-quality education to its students.
